Game Recap: Baseball | | Braden Treaster, Director of Athletic Communications

Wolves Swept by Railsplitters in Saturday Twibill

HARROGATE, TENN. - The Newberry College baseball team (21-25, 15-12) dropped a pair of games Saturday afternoon at Lincoln Memorial, 14-3 and 12-4.

Junior outfielder Donovan Ford went 3-for-6 with a triple, two stolen bases, a run scored and another driven in while extending his hitting streak to 25 games.  He is six hits away from becoming the ninth player in Newberry history to collect 200 career hits.

Kade Faircloth also had hits in each game, going 3-for-5 with a run scored and a run batted in.

It is the team's first conference series loss since late February.

The Wolves host Emory & Henry in a three-game series to close out the regular season beginning Friday starting at 6:00 p.m. at Smith Road Complex.

A win Friday will clinch a berth to the South Atlantic Conference postseason tournament.
